Position Summary:

Our company and our team are experiencing exciting growth, and an opportunity exists for a Senior Data Analyst to partner with the Data Engineering team and the business stakeholders to create business intelligence solutions that deliver insight to aide decision making.

The need for an end lesscuriosity, a love for and the effective use of data and a passion for visual story telling will be key components of our ideal candidate. You will be prepared to partner with the business to drive value from the insights you provide.


Essential Functions / Job Responsibilities:

• Report design & development – partnering with business departments in building out reports/reporting environments to meet the evolving needs of internal customers (primarily within Microsoft PowerBI)

• Identify, analyze, and interpret trends or patterns in complex data sets

• Uses data patterns and trends to root cause operational gaps and inefficiency, develop solutions in collaboration with business teams

• Contributes to the evelopment/advancement of the data infrastructure

• Critically evaluates information gathered from multiple sources, reconcile, and identify gaps, uncover unmet business needs to suggest for metrics and dashboards

• Where required, pull together raw data from multiple platforms, build appropriate data visualizations in dashboards, and structure analysis with meaningful, relevant insights

• Manage the Data Analytics reporting backlog

Skills Required:

• Hands on development experience building dynamic dashboards using PowerBI, Tableau, Mode Analytics or similar BI tool

• A strong eye and skill for dashboard design and visual storytelling. Highly competent in Microsoft Excel for partnering with stakeholders (Private Equity, Operations, Finance/Accounting)

• Experience in data modeling, particularly with subscription models

• Experience with data warehousing using Redshift, Snowflake, or other similar OLAP warehouse solution

• Experience with data/query languages (SQL, DAX, Power Query)and a general-purpose programming language like Python

• Ability to work on concurrent projects and meet time sensitive reporting dates

• Strong problem-solving skills and an intellectual curiosity toward existing processes and possible improvements


• A business background

• Excellent communication skills with all levels of the organization

Nice to have:

• Experience automating workflows with Power Automate

• Experience with AWS Glue/Data Brew (cleansing and transforming data sets) preferred

• Some experience applying open-source machine learning models for ad-hoc analysis and prediction preferred
